Dr. King is a board-certified adult psychiatrist who holds dual medical licenses in Tennessee and the District of Columbia. He graduated from American University of the Caribbean and completed dual residencies in neurology and psychiatry at Morehouse School of Medicine in Atlanta, Georgia and Howard University Hospital, Washington, DC. After completion of his residencies, Dr. King became board certified by the American Academy of Neurology and Psychiatry in 2001.
Dr. King relocated to Franklin to begin working with Tennessee Psychiatry in 2022. He currently supervises nurse practitioners in the Tennessee Psychiatry’s offices in Franklin and Jackson.
